March 2019: Canada Update

Health Canada finalizes regulations to provide public access to clinical information on drugs and medical devices

Health Canada regulation on “public access to clinical information on drugs and medical devices” is finally going to be published on March 20,2019 as per their Press release dated 13 Mar 2019.

On March 20, 2019, Health Canada will publish final regulations that allow for the public release of clinical information on drugs and medical devices. Clinical information is the data that companies provide when requesting authorization of these products, and includes study reports and clinical trial results. These regulations are one of the key transparency measures introduced under Vanessa’s Law.

Clinical information will be made available to Canadians through Health Canada’s new Clinical Information Portal as of March 13, 2019.

Proactive disclosure for medical devices will start in 2021, to coincide with steps the European Union is taking to increase the transparency of clinical information for medical devices, and to reduce the burden on stakeholders by aligning approaches”
